Delete Metro Mirror relationship

Use this page to select either a source volume or target volume on which a specific Metro Mirror relationship is deleted against.

Introduction

The deletion is applied to the volume that you selected. For example, if you select a target volume, the deletion only affects the relationship for which it is a target volume.
Note: You must have created a Metro Mirror relationship and it must be listed in the table before you can delete it.

Before you issue this request, you should verify whether there are some active paths between the respective source and target LSSs that are associated with the specific relationship. When you delete a Metro Mirror relationship, the relationship between the source and target volume ends, if all the paths are available to the target volume.

Fields

Terminate on source
Upon your confirmation, the specific relationship is deleted on the source volume. As a result, the selected source and the target volume go to a simplex state.
Terminate on target
Upon your confirmation, the specific relationship is deleted on the target volume. As a result, the source volume is in suspended state and the target volume in a simplex state. This option is useful in a disaster situation when the local site has gone down.
